As a Risk Adjustment Operations Leader, your primary responsibilities may include :

Product Roadmap Development and Maintenance

Lead the development and continuous refinement of the firm's r isk a djustment product roadmap.

Ensure the product offering leverages cutting-edge technology, including AI-driven chart reviews and advanced analytics.

Performance Management

Establish and oversee performance management processes, ensuring operational excellence and superior client outcomes.

Develop and maintain reporting frameworks to monitor performance metrics, identifying areas for improvement.

Client Management

Serve as the subject matter advisor and primary point of contact for health clients for risk adjustment services .

Proactively identify and communicate risks, issues, and improvement opportunities to clients.

Set and manage client expectations, ensuring satisfaction and alignment with service objectives .

Regulatory Compliance

Monitor regulatory changes, including CMS and HHS guidelines, and ensure risk adjustment services remain compliant.

Oversee enhancements to processes and tools in response to evolving regulatory requirements.

Operational Excellence

Oversee the performance of automated processes, including AI-based chart reviews and risk adjustment analytics.

Identify opportunities to improve speed, breadth, and accuracy of risk adjustment operations.

Business Development

Support sales initiatives, contributing to proposals and presentations to secure new clients.

Leverage industry insights to identify growth opportunities and expand the firm's risk adjustment client base.

Team Leadership

Build, mentor, and provide strategic direction to a team of junior resources.

Foster a culture of continuous improvement, ensuring the team delivers high-quality, efficient services.

Travel

  • As needed, up to 80%

Here's what you need : ? ?

Bachelor's degree in Business Administration , Health Administration, Information Technology, or related field preferred.

A minimum of 5 years of experience in healthcare consulting, or risk management operations with a health plan or risk adjustment service provider.

A minimum of 5 years of experience planning, securing funding for, and executing a roadmap for continual improvement of risk adjustment capabilities .

Bonus points if you have : ?

Master's degree preferred.

Experience working with or leading global teams.?

Thrive in a diverse, fast paced environment.?

Exceptional problem-solving and analytical skills.

Excellent communication and presentation abilities.

Leadership experience, including team management and project oversight.?

Experience leveraging automation for medical chart capture and AI for supporting medical chart reviews.

Experience presenting operational and financial impacts of risk adjustment services to health plan leadership.

Participated in CMS compliance audits.

Certified medical coder.
